Green Lentils Salad with Smoked Trout

The green lentils du Puy are from Le Puy En Velay, a volcanic region located in South-East of Auvergne (France). These green lentils have been cultivated for 2000 years. Fiadone

Fiadone is a delicious type of cheese cake from Corsica (France), different from North American cheese cake, simple and easy to bake.
